The Complete Guide to Image Optimization for SEO
Images play a crucial role in how users experience your website — they make content engaging and visually appealing. But without proper optimization, images can slow down your site, hurt search rankings, and increase bandwidth costs. This guide covers how to optimize images for SEO while keeping them sharp and professional.
Why Image Optimization Matters for SEO
Search engines consider page load speed a ranking factor. Large, unoptimized images can slow your site, leading to lower rankings and poor UX.
Proper optimization improves:
- Page speed: Smaller file sizes mean faster load times.
- User experience: Visitors stay longer on fast, visually appealing pages.
- Search visibility: Optimized images can rank in Google Images and drive extra traffic.
Key Steps for Image Optimization
1. Choose the Right File Format
Each format has its strengths:
- JPEG: Best for photos and complex images; supports lossy compression.
- PNG: Great for transparency; lossless compression.
- WebP: Modern format with superior compression/quality.
2. Compress Without Losing Quality
With JPEGMinify, reduce image sizes without noticeable quality loss — ideal for product photos and banners.
3. Resize Images to Actual Display Size
Don’t upload a 4000px‑wide image if it’s displayed at 800px. Resize first to save bandwidth and speed up pages.
4. Add Descriptive Filenames
Search engines read filenames. Prefer red-running-shoes.jpg
over IMG_1234.jpg
.
5. Use Alt Text for Accessibility and SEO
Alt text helps screen readers and gives search engines context. Be concise and descriptive.
6. Implement Lazy Loading
Load below‑the‑fold images only when needed to reduce initial payload.
7. Serve Images via CDN
CDNs like Cloudflare deliver images faster worldwide and can add on‑the‑fly optimizations.
Best Practices for SEO‑Friendly Images
- Use responsive images with
srcset
. - Prefer WebP/AVIF for modern browsers, keep JPEG/PNG fallbacks.
- Keep images under ~200KB where possible.
- Audit and replace oversized images regularly.
Conclusion
Use JPEGMinify to compress images, choose the right formats, and follow these best practices to boost speed, rankings, and UX.
Related Guides
- How to Reduce JPEG File Size Without Losing Quality
- How Progressive JPEGs Improve Website Speed
- Best Practices for Batch Image Optimization
Optimize Your Images Now
Use JPEGMinify to compress images for SEO — fast, private, and free.
Compress My Images